Shelburne County Arts Council is a charitable organization based in Shelburne, Nova Scotia, classified by the CRA under education in the arts. It appears on the charity register the way hospitals, universities, and other publicly funded bodies do — to issue tax receipts — rather than as a donation-driven charity in the usual sense. In its fiscal year ending December 31, 2024, it reported $24K in revenue and $23K in expenditures.

Its funding that year was roughly 71% from government. Government funding is the majority of its budget. In 2024, 1 other registered charity reported granting it a combined $75.

Compared with 673 education institutions of similar size, its share of spending on mission — charitable programs plus grants to other charities — ranked above 26% of peers. The charity reported 1 permanent full-time position.

Revenue has grown substantially over its filings on record here, from $12K in 2020 to $24K in 2024.
